upper hand
noun
to have the upper hand avere la meglio
to gain or get the upper hand prendere il sopravvento
INGLESE
ITALIANO
ITALIANO
INGLESEComplétez la séquence avec la proposition qui convient.
Hurry up! The bus is coming, we don't want to miss ….